Understanding CNC Machining Benefits

To understand how CNC machining can assist small manufacturers, we spoke with various industry leaders who shared their insights.

Expert Insights on Efficiency Gains

John Thompson, a production efficiency specialist, stated, “CNC machining allows small manufacturers to automate repetitive tasks, which can reduce labor costs significantly. This automation ensures that quality remains consistent across products.” Automation eliminates the variance often introduced by manual labor, leading to fewer errors and less waste.

Precision and Quality Control

Susan Lee, an engineer from a renowned CNC machining firm, emphasized the importance of precision: “CNC machines can produce parts with tolerances of up to ±0.001 inches, which is critical for industries that rely on precision engineering, such as aerospace and medical devices.” This precision translates to higher-quality products that meet customer demands more effectively, allowing small manufacturers to compete on a larger scale.

Faster Turnaround Times

According to Raj Patel, a production manager at a Vietnam CNC machining company, the speed of CNC machining processes leads to shorter lead times: “With CNC technology, the time from design to production decreases drastically. This speed means that we can respond to market changes swiftly and effectively.” Quick turnaround not only satisfies customer requirements but also allows small businesses to take on more projects.

Cost-Effectiveness of CNC Machining

Many experts argue that the initial investment in CNC technology pays off rapidly. Derek Wong, a financial analyst specializing in manufacturing investments, noted, “While there is a notable upfront cost, the reduction in production costs and the ability to meet more client demands without a proportional increase in labor makes CNC machining a financially sound decision for small manufacturers.”

Scalability of Operations

Another advantage highlighted by Caroline Reyes, a manufacturing consultant, is scalability. “CNC machining systems can be scaled up or down depending on project needs. This flexibility is crucial for small manufacturers who might experience fluctuating demand,” she explained. This adaptability ensures sustained production efficiency, regardless of market conditions.

Integration with Modern Technologies

Moreover, David Chen, a technology strategist, mentioned how CNC machining integrates seamlessly with modern software solutions. “With the rise of Industry 4.0, CNC machines can be equipped with smart technology that allows for real-time monitoring and adjustments. This leads to further optimization of production processes,” he commented.
